    I’ve watched this so many times! Great, tutorial on how to set up and take down. I don’t think anyone else has such a detailed tutorial. How come you don’t stake all the ground pins on once?

    • @BaylilyBellTents
      @BaylilyBellTents  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Thanks so much for watching! We have found that by starting with those first six pegs you get a much more even groundsheet and it doesn’t sag in the corners 👍

    Great video, thank you. Have you recorded a 6m put up video also? Or is it pretty much exactly the same principle as above? Any differences apart from it being slightly harder? Thank you

    • @BaylilyBellTents
      @BaylilyBellTents  3 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hey @Mark Lennox, no we haven't.. Interestingly we are recording a 7m this week if that could help! However, the principal is exactly the same, just slightly bigger and heavier.. Do be aware if its wet on set up [unlikely granted] as it then becomes very heavy..

    • @marklennox176
      @marklennox176 3 ปีที่แล้ว

      @@BaylilyBellTents ok perfect, thank you. And yes I'll look out for the 7m put up. I can do the 6m solo and actually followed your advice for the 5m - it's just the central pole which takes a bit more effort as it seems to create a vacuum when dragging it to the middle and up. Anyway, your 7m will give some good tips I'm sure.

    • @BaylilyBellTents
      @BaylilyBellTents  3 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Yes, it really does create a vacuum... You can either 'waft' the door a bit to let some air in or I find pushing the pole vertical as soon as it's in place and you can really helps. One hand up as high as possible pushing vertical and one hand as low as possible pulling the bottom into place.. Thank you so much for watching our videos... 😊

    I had a question about the tent pegs.There's a loop on the outside of the groundsheet that the tent peg is threaded through before the peg is staked into the ground. What's the function of that loop for the tie-down, and is it necessary to attach it to the tent peg? I ask because we're going to be using lag bolts to drill into playa and won't have those thing pegs with us. I can run additional cord between that loop and a carabiner on the lag bolt, but I'm wondering if that's necessary? Thanks!

    • @BaylilyBellTents
      @BaylilyBellTents  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Hey…
      Great question… The loop is not structural or integral, so you could leave it out on your system.
      It’s job is to relive pressure on zips and keep the sides looking neat and tidy…

    Hi, you said not to lay it out like you did in the tutorial if it's raining, how would you go about getting one of these up if it is raining?
    Cheers.

    • @BaylilyBellTents
      @BaylilyBellTents  ปีที่แล้ว +2

      Hi Chris, sorry for the delay in replying... So yes, dont lay it out for any period of time if raining as the rain will go through he canvas, as the canvas is touching the floor... The only way to put one up when it's raining, is to do it quickly.. Just go for it and get that centre pole up as quickly as possible, so the canvas doesn't touch the floor.. Good luck..
